tarifa acabo lineas format number datatable

This commit is contained in:
amazuecos
2025-02-09 12:14:34 +01:00
parent ad8bdb7d5e
commit aebc38a126

View File

@ -124,7 +124,12 @@
} }
}, { }, {
name: "precio_max" name: "precio_max",
attr: {
type: "text",
name : "precio_max",
class :"autonumeric"
}
}, { }, {
name: "tirada_max", name: "tirada_max",
attr: { attr: {
@ -133,9 +138,19 @@
class :"autonumeric" class :"autonumeric"
} }
}, { }, {
name: "precio_min" name: "precio_min",
attr: {
type: "text",
name : "precio_min",
class :"autonumeric"
}
},{ },{
name: "margen" name: "margen",
attr: {
type: "text",
name : "margen",
class :"autonumeric"
}
}, { }, {
"name": "tarifa_acabado_id", "name": "tarifa_acabado_id",
"type": "hidden" "type": "hidden"
@ -163,11 +178,13 @@
} }
new AutoNumeric(this, { new AutoNumeric(this, {
decimalCharacter: ",", digitGroupSeparator: ".",
decimalPlaces : 0, decimalCharacter: ",",
digitGroupSeparator: ".", allowDecimalPadding : 'floats',
unformatOnSubmit : true, decimalPlaces: 2,
}); unformatOnSubmit: true,
});
}) })
}) })
editor.on( 'preSubmit', function ( e, d, type ) { editor.on( 'preSubmit', function ( e, d, type ) {
@ -313,10 +330,10 @@
}, },
}, },
{ 'data': 'tirada_min',render : (d) => `<span class="autonumeric">${d}</span>` }, { 'data': 'tirada_min',render : (d) => `<span class="autonumeric">${d}</span>` },
{ 'data': 'precio_max' }, { 'data': 'precio_max',render : (d) => `<span class="autonumeric">${d}</span>` },
{ 'data': 'tirada_max',render : (d) => `<span class="autonumeric">${d}</span>` }, { 'data': 'tirada_max',render : (d) => `<span class="autonumeric">${d}</span>` },
{ 'data': 'precio_min' }, { 'data': 'precio_min',render : (d) => `<span class="autonumeric">${d}</span>` },
{ 'data': 'margen' }, { 'data': 'margen',render : (d) => `<span class="autonumeric">${d}</span>` },
{ {
data: actionBtns, data: actionBtns,
className: 'row-edit dt-center' className: 'row-edit dt-center'
@ -360,14 +377,7 @@
} }
); );
} ); } );
theTable.on('draw',() => {
AutoNumeric.multiple("span.autonumeric", {
digitGroupSeparator: ".",
decimalCharacter: ",",
decimalPlaces : 0,
unformatOnSubmit: true
});
})
// Delete row // Delete row
$(document).on('click', '.btn-delete', function(e) { $(document).on('click', '.btn-delete', function(e) {